1.
Chinese Health Economics ; (12): 45-48, 2024.
Artigo em Chinês | WPRIM | ID: wpr-1025243

RESUMO

Objective:It analyzed the population aggregation characteristics of the treatment costs for Traditional Chinese Medi-cine(TCM)dominant diseases,and make targeted recommendations for relevant health policies.Methods:A total of 205 medical insti-tutions were obtained through stratified whole-cluster sampling to analyze the composition of the beneficiary population based on Sys-tem of Health Accounts 2011 for the treatment costs of TCM dominant diseases for local residents in Beijing in 2019.Results:The treatment costs of Beijing's TCM dominant diseases are dominated by diseases that include basic western medicine treatment,with male patients'costs accounting for a higher proportion than those of females,and the trend of younger patients in types of diseases treated by TCM and the costs have mainly flowed to females,with more than 50%of the treatment costs being consumed by patients aged 60 years old and above.Conclusion:It is needed to pay attention to male and child patients aged 0~14 years and their priority diseases,strengthen the construction of Chinese medicine geriatric health services,and adopt differentiated strategies for different groups of people so as to maximize the advantages of Chinese medicine.

2.
Artigo em Chinês | WPRIM | ID: wpr-450778

RESUMO

Objective To evaluate the synchrony of heart after catheter-based renal denervation by two dimensional speckle tracking imaging.Methods Each renal sympathetic nerve of 20 dogs were ablated,and the index of heart and blood pressure were detected 6 weeks later.Standard 2D images were acquired in the 2-,3-and 4-apical views.The times from QRS onset to peak-systolic strain rate and to peak-diastolic strain rate were measured for the longitudinal 16-segments in Qlab software,and the standard deviation were calculated.The time to peak longitudinal strain rate and time to peak contraction strain rate of left atrium were measured for each segment contained septal,latera,anterior and posterior in the level of the basal segments,middle sections and apical in Qlab software,and the standard deviation were calculated.Parameters were compared among the before and after of the ablation.Results The systolic pressure and diastolic pressure had no changes after the ablation of renal sympathetic nerve (P > 0.05).The R-R showed a increasing trend,but no significant differences(P >0.05).The peak time of LV systolic and diastolic strain rate had a extended trendency too,but no differences(P >0.05),and standard deviations of the peak times had no significant differences(P >0.05).The peak time of LA longitudinal strain rate and contraction strain rate had a extended trendency,but no obvious change (P >0.05),and the standard deviations of the peak times had no significant differences (P >0.05).The size of the heart cavity had no differences(P >0.05).Conclusions The systolic pressure and diastolic pressure have no changes after the ablation of renal sympathetic nerve,and the synchrony parameters of LV and LA have no significant differences,demonstrate that the synchrony of heart is not affected by the renal sympathetic denervation.

3.
Chinese Journal of Ultrasonography ; (12): 997-1000, 2013.
Artigo em Chinês | WPRIM | ID: wpr-439217

RESUMO

Objective To evaluate the security of catheter-based renal denervation by two dimensional speckle tracking imaging.Methods 20 dogs was ablated,whose indicies of heart and blood pressure were detected 6 weeks later.Standard 2D images were acquired in the 2-,3-and 4-apical views as well as the parasternal short-axis views at the level of the mitral valve and papillary muscles.The time to peak-systolic strain of each segment in the level of the mitral valve and papillary muscles,the standard deviation of the time to peak-systolic strain,the peak strain of the longitudinal 12-segment were recorded.Parameters were compared among the before and after ablation.Results Compared with before ablation of renal sympathetic nerve,the systolic pressure and diastolic pressure didn't reduced significantly after the ablation of renal sympathetic nerve (P > 0.05),while there were no significant difference in the peak strain of the longitudinal 12-segment,the dyssychrony parameters and the size of the heart cavity before and after ablation(P >0.05).Conclusions The pressure had no change after the ablation of renal sympathetic nerve while without harmful effect on the the size of the heart cavity,the function of the myocardial contraction and the dyssychrony parameters.The ablation of renal sympathetic nerve can' t lower the normal blood pressure and be safe for heart at the same time.
